A "Read Me" text is frequently the initial thing you'll find when you get a new program or project . Think of it as a short overview to what you’re working with . It typically provides key specifics about the project’s purpose, how to set up it, potential issues, and even how to assist to the work . Don’t ignore it – reading the Read Me can protect you from a considerable trouble and allow you started quickly .
The Importance of Read Me Files in Software Development
A well-crafted documentation file, often referred to as a "Read Me," is undeniably vital in software creation . It provides as the primary source of understanding for prospective users, collaborators, and sometimes the initial creators . Without a thorough Read Me, users might struggle setting up the software, grasping its functionality , or contributing in its improvement . Therefore, a comprehensive Read Me file significantly improves the user experience and facilitates collaboration within the initiative .
Read Me Documents : What Needs to Be Featured ?
A well-crafted Getting Started file is vital for any project . It serves as the initial point of contact for users , providing vital information to launch and understand the system . Here’s what you need to include:
- Project Description : Briefly explain the purpose of the application.
- Installation Instructions : A detailed guide on how to set up the project .
- Usage Examples : Show contributors how to really use the software with easy demonstrations .
- Dependencies : List all essential dependencies and their releases .
- Contributing Policies : If you welcome assistance, clearly outline the procedure .
- License Information : State the license under which the project is distributed .
- Support Details : Provide channels for developers to receive support .
A comprehensive README file reduces frustration and supports successful use of your project .
Common Mistakes in Read Me File Writing
Many developers frequently encounter errors when producing Read Me guides, hindering user understanding and implementation. A substantial portion of frustration arises from easily preventable issues. Here are a few frequent pitfalls to avoid:
- Insufficient information: Failing to explain the application's purpose, functions, and platform requirements leaves potential users lost.
- Missing deployment directions: This is perhaps the most oversight . Users require clear, sequential guidance to successfully set up the software.
- Lack of practical illustrations : Providing concrete cases helps users understand how to effectively utilize the tool .
- Ignoring error information : Addressing common issues and offering solutions helps reduce support requests .
- Poor organization: A cluttered Read Me file is challenging to understand, discouraging users from engaging with the program.
Keep in mind that a well-written Read Me file is an benefit that pays off in higher user contentment and usage .
Above the Fundamentals : Advanced Read Me Document Approaches
Many developers think a simple “Read Me” document is adequate , but genuinely effective software documentation goes far further that. Consider implementing sections for in-depth deployment instructions, outlining platform requirements , and providing troubleshooting tips . Don’t overlook to include examples of typical use cases , and consistently revise the file as the software progresses . For significant applications , a overview and internal links are essential for ease of browsing . Finally, use a consistent format and concise phrasing to optimize reader grasp.
Read Me Files: A Historical Perspective
The humble "Read Me" file possesses a surprisingly long history . Initially arising alongside the early days of programs , these straightforward files served as a necessary means to present installation here instructions, licensing details, or brief explanations – often penned by individual creators directly. Before the common adoption of graphical user screens, users depended these text-based manuals to navigate challenging systems, marking them as a key part of the initial computing landscape.
Comments on “Understanding Read Me Files: A Beginner's Guide”